Francisca Pena Garcia [Spanish: Peña García], known as Sister Maria de Jesus [Spanish: María de Jesús] (5 May 1912 – 24 November 2022), was a Mexican supercentenarian whose age was validated by the Gerontology Research Group (GRG) in 2023.
Biography[]
Francisca Pena Garcia was born in Penjamo, Guanajuato, Mexico on 5 May 1912. She became a nun at the age of 26, on 24 December 1938.
In May 2022, she celebrated her 110th birthday and became a supercentenarian.
She died in Orizaba, Veracruz, Mexico on 24 November 2022 at the age of 110 years, 203 days.
Recognition[]
At the time of her death, she was the oldest known living nun in Mexico, as well as the sixth-oldest known (documented) living person in the country.
